Monterrey is located in Mexico's northeast desert area at the edge of the Sierra Madre Oriental mountain range at an altitude of approximately 3,000 feet. The city of Monterrey possesses a fairly radical climate, with quick changes in the weather possible at any time, summer or winter. The evenings can get quite cold in the winter and summers in Monterrey are usually very hot. Afternoon rains come during the summer months, mainly late June to September. Normally the rain lasts foronly a few hours after which the sun comes out and the air is much cleaner. November to June are, most often, the driest months.
It is fairy easy to get to Monterrey from almost everywhere in North America by car, bus or plane. The Mariano Escobedo International Airport, one of the nicest in Mexico, is modern, clean and very easy to navigate. The airport is host to over 300 international and domestic flights every day. The airport is approximately 30 to 45 minutes from downtown Monterrey.
